Job Description

The responsibilities of a Project Executive:

  • Lead higher education construction projects from preconstruction through completion
  • Oversee project teams, schedules, budgets, and overall project execution
  • Maintain strong client relationships and ensure exceptional client satisfaction
  • Drive project profitability while managing risk and quality standards
  • Coordinate with operations, preconstruction, design teams, and field leadership
  • Monitor project performance and proactively resolve challenges
  • Mentor and develop project management staff
  • Collaborate with executive leadership on project strategy and resource planning
  • Ensure compliance with company standards, safety requirements, and contractual obligations
  • Support business growth through excellent project delivery and client retention

The Successful Applicant

A successful Project Executive should have:

  • Bachelor's degree in Construction Management, Engineering, or a related field
  • 10-12+ years of commercial construction experience
  • General Contractor experience required
  • Experience leading higher education projects from start to finish
  • Proven experience managing projects exceeding $30 million
  • Demonstrated track record of delivering profitable projects and maintaining client satisfaction
  • Strong leadership, communication, and team management skills
  • Proficiency with Microsoft Office 365, Procore, and Bluebeam
  • Working knowledge of Primavera scheduling and BIM processes
  • Strong Senior Project Managers with relevant project experience will also be considered
